Output 345746efb36e4d3eaf50579ae5f6c81b2c853fdce31ac06b6f709ac469567293:13

value
18777862
script pubkey
OP_0 OP_PUSHBYTES_20 a0b6eac3a14b36ac85d0e67254442f360801a05e
address
ltc1q5zmw4sapfvm2epwsuee9g3p0xcyqrgz7a4m3l2
transaction
345746efb36e4d3eaf50579ae5f6c81b2c853fdce31ac06b6f709ac469567293
spent
true